Chemical Weathering Rocks are changed by chemical and physical weathering. During chemical weathering, the composition of the rock is changed. Extreme heat and pressure within Earth can also cause rocks to change chemically. Physical weathering is the breaking down of rock by wind, water, ice, temperature change, and plants. It changes the shape and size of rocks, but it does not change their properties.

You must know the concept of pH of a solution and its relation to the concentration of H+ and OH- ions. pH is a measure of the substance's acidity or basicity. From the definition of Arrhenius, an acid contains an H+ while a base contains a OH- ion. From this definition, we can say that an acidic substance has a higher concentration of H+ ions. Now, I'll introduce here that pH is the value of the negative logarithm of the concentration of H+. In equation,
pH = -log[H+]
The term pOH is therefore also, pOH = -log[OH-]. Therefore, the relationship that connects the two negative logarithms is:
pH + pOH = 14
The pH scale starts from 1 being the most acidic to 14 being the most basic. The neutral pH is 7. Thus, for a pH of 7, the H+ and the OH- concentrations are equal.
pH = 7 = -log[H+]
[H+] = 1×10⁻⁷ mol/L = [OH-]

A voltaic cell, also known as a galvanic cell or an electrochemical cell, is an electrochemical device that generates electrical energy through a spontaneous chemical reaction. It consists of two half-cells connected by an external circuit and a salt bridge or porous barrier that allows the flow of ions between the two half-cells.
Each half-cell consists of an electrode immersed in an electrolyte solution. The electrode is typically made of a metal or a conductive material, and the electrolyte is a solution containing ions that can participate in the redox (reduction-oxidation) reaction.

Asexual reproduction is a type of reproduction where only a single parent is involved in creating offspring. The offspring reproduced are genetically identical to the parent. while this form of reproduction has many advantages including rapid and quick reproduction, it posses some major drawbacks as well.
As the genetic diversity is absent in asexual reproduction, adapting and surviving in the dynamic environment is tough for the offspring. Difficulty in catching up with the changing circumstances can sometimes lead to harm to upcoming species.

Understory Layer
Located several meters below the canopy, the understory is an even darker, stiller, and more humid environment. Plants here, such as palms and philodendrons, are much shorter and have larger leaves than plants that dominate the canopy. Understory plants’ large leaves catch the minimal sunlight reaching beyond the dense canopy.
